github的介绍

一、gitHub是什么

GitHub 是一个面向开源及私有软件项目的托管平台,因为只支持 Git 作为唯一的版本库格式进行托管,故名 GitHub。

git是一个开源的分布式版本控制系统,用以有效、高速的处理从很小到非常大的项目版本管理。

二、github作用

github可以说是所有程序员的宝库,里面都是一些开源项目,可供参考和学习。同时自己开发的业余项目也可以通过git上传到GitHub上。

github可以看作是软件项目的托管平台,可以理解为存储软件项目的服务器。

github是一个基于git的代码托管平台,付费用户可以建私人仓库,不被共享。只有自己可见。

我们一般的免费用户只能使用公共仓库,也就是代码要公开。对于一般人来说公共仓库就已经足够了,而且我们也没多少代码来管理。

我们在GitHub上可以创建多个公共仓库。

三、如何使用GitHub

1、注册账户

要想使用github第一步当然是注册github账号了, github官网地址:https://github.com/。

2、 创建仓库

登录 GitHub, 在右上角找到 New Repository 或者 加号下拉按钮(+),点击进入新建仓库

依次填写仓库名,以及其他信息后,点击 "Create repository" 按钮,即可创建一个在线仓库. 因为这个仓库是挂在你的账号下的,所以可以是任意合法的字符,只要和你的其他仓库不冲突即可.

仓库创建成功后,就会进入仓库预览页面, 如下图所示:

然后,我们可以点击右边的 HTTPS 链接, 上方的文本框里面就显示了 HTTPS协议下的仓库访问地址, 可以点击进去全选,也可以点击右边的复制按钮复制到剪贴板.

例如,刚刚创建的项目访问路径是:

 https://github.com/cncounter/LispGentleIntro.git

是一个以 https:// 开始,以 .git 结尾的 URL,根据提示,叫做 clone URL.

好了,仓库创建完成。

github只是一个存储软件项目的托管平台,我们要把本地项目上传到GitHub的仓库以及从GitHub的仓库里获取项目到本地,还需要借助git。

时间: 2024-12-18 16:00:04

github的介绍的相关文章

Github入门级介绍

Github入门级介绍 一.  简介 1.基本功能 作为开源代码库以及版本控制系统,Github拥有超过900万开发者用户.随着越来越多的应用程序转移到了云上,Github已经成为了管理软件开发以及发现已有代码的首选方法. 在GitHub,用户可以十分轻易地找到海量的开源代码. 二.  注册 1.  登录 https://github.com/ ,点击右上角的注册按钮,输入自己用户名.邮箱.密码等等. 2.  验证码,需要把一个小狗摆正 3.  选择免费/付费账号 一般选择免费,上传的代码会公开

GitHub官方介绍

官方链接地址 http://guides.github.com/activities/hello-world/ Hello World 项目在计算机编程界是一项历史悠久的传统.当你开始学习一些新的东西时,这个项目是一项简单的练习.让我们开始用GitHub开始吧! 你可以学到怎样去做: 创造并使用一个储存库 开始并管理一个新的分支 对一个文件进行改动并且把他们推送到GitHub作为提交 打开并合并一个提取请求 什么是GitHub? GitHub是一个版本控制和协作的代码管理平台.它可以让你和他人在

git和github -1 介绍

1. git — 工具,版本控制 作用:回到过去的状态.找回丢失的内容.多人协作开发( 解决冲突 ).查看历史记录等 2. github — 网站,社交平台,开源项目,远程仓库 ( 例:可直接修改代码,然后请求合并 ) 优点:a. 强大啊的协作 b. 减少冲突 c. 最大的源码开放平台 d. 更多知识和工具

Github开篇介绍

其实我第一次用github的时候,其实我是,是拒绝的.我拒绝,因为,我从来没有用过github,我就是这样很土,很out 了解了一下github后,觉得,很不错,林纳斯跟我讲,用完加特技.你的代码就很炫,很亮,很牛.在用了一两次之后,我就喜欢上了github,duang~的一下 github能有效管理你的源码.还可以分享给大家看,大家也能修改你的代码,评论你的代码,你也能对别人做同样的工作,这样你的水平就会提高. 关注了一些大神后,我觉得我要开始写博客了.然后我又发现github能放自己的网站,

github使用介绍

Git支持多种协议,默认的git://使用ssh,但也可以使用https等其他协议. 使用https除了速度慢以外,还有个最大的麻烦是每次推送都必须输入口令,但是在某些只开放http端口的公司内部就无法使用ssh协议而只能用https. 使用https: git clone https://[email protected]/Tenderrain/gitskills.git 需要输入github注册用户对应的密码 使用ssh: git clone [email protected]:Tender

github 专案介绍 – Python 范例:透过互动式的 Jupyter 和数学解释流行的机器学习演算法

对于机器学习有兴趣,不少人应该会先从 Andrew Ng ( 吴恩达 ) 的机器学习课程开始,但是吴恩达的课程是使用 octave 这个工具当作练习.这个 github 项目包含使用 Python 实现流行机器学习算法的范例,并解释了其背后的 数学原理. 每个算法都有交互式的 Jupyter Notebook 示范,可以让你玩训练数据.算法配置,并立即在浏览器中 检视结果.图表和预测. 在大多数情况下,这些解释都是基于 Andrew Ng 的这门伟大的机器学习课程. 这个储存库的目的不是通过使用

Git和Github的介绍、简单操作

目的:   1.git与github简介  2.Git与SVN区别 3.Github 的简单使用 4.下载安装Git-20-64-bit.exe   5.Git常用命令 5.1Git命令使用场景 5.2常用命令 5.3实践操作:使用git提交文件至远程仓库 Git与Github简介 Git简介:Git是一个开源的[分布式][版本控制系统],用于敏捷高效地处理任何或小或大的项目 版本控制器: CVS/SVN/Git SVN: 客户端/服务器 GIT: 客户端/代码托管网站(例如:github) 注

Github上README.md介绍

开始使用Github , 发现介绍README.md 的文章 以下摘自http://guoyunsky.iteye.com/blog/1781885 1 大标题 2 =================================== 3 大标题一般显示工程名,类似html的\<h1\><br /> 4 你只要在标题下面跟上=====即可 5 6 7 中标题 8 ----------------------------------- 9 中标题一般显示重点项,类似html的\&l

如何把项目托管到GitHub

此篇根据他人经验文章修改并测试 如何把项目托管到GitHub 说明:本文主要介绍如何把一个OC项目托管到Github,重操作轻理论. 第一步:先注册一个Github的账号,这是必须的 注册地址:Github官网注册入口 第二步:准备工作 gitHub网站使用Git版本管理工具来对仓库进行管理,注意它们并不等同. gitHub是全球最大的第三方开源库集散地,Git是一款分布式的版本管理控制工具(除了git之外还有一些其他的版本管理控制工具如SVN等). 关于Git的基本介绍以及基本使用这里不会做更